Driving directions from Nakhon Si Thammarat, Thailand to Shanghai, China distance


Nakhon Si Thammarat, Thailand
Shanghai, China
Nakhon Si Thammarat to Shanghai road map

Nakhon Si Thammarat to Shanghai flight distance miles / km

2,095.7 mi / 3,372.6 km
Also see in Thailand
Of interest in China